Plane trees (family Platanaceae), oak (Quercus spp) and elm (Ulmaceae) trees and ryegrass (Lolium spp) are the usual suspects for hayfever.

Australian natives such as the Myrtaceae and Acacia release huge quantities of pollen at this time of year too, but the pollen spores are mostly too large to trigger an immune response.

Yep. Plane trees. Council planted them along my street last year and they have doubled in size. I'm going to have to get my canadian mate who is coming over to fix my window so that it isn't just gaffer-taped closed, cos once those trees get big enough it'll be hell.

The zoology department in Adelaide uni used to have all the windows on one side of the building welded shut cos that side of the building was next to a street lined with plane trees.

Don't know why councils keep on using them. Well, I do... they are cheap, they are hardy, resist air, soil and groundwater pollution and they grow rapidly. But they are also a nightmare for hayfever sufferers. Should plant Metasequoia glyptostroboides (Dawn Redwood). Critically endangered, fast growing, beautiful foliage and a living fossil to boot.
